Music quality is everything when it comes to bands like Linkin Park—their layered soundscapes deserve the best listening experience. If you're aiming for CD quality (16-bit/44.1kHz), start by sourcing lossless files. Platforms like Qobuz or HDtracks often offer albums like 'Hybrid Theory' or 'Meteora' in FLAC or ALAC formats, which preserve every detail. Physical CDs are another solid option; rip them using software like Exact Audio Copy for bit-perfect accuracy. For playback, skip compressed streaming services unless they support high-res tiers (like Tidal’s HiFi plan). Invest in decent equipment—a DAC (digital-to-analog converter) can elevate sound from basic laptop outputs. Headphones matter too; open-back models like Sennheiser HD 600 reveal nuances in Chester’s vocals or the crunch of Brad’s guitar. When did Linkin Park release with you linkin park lyrics?

5 Jawaban2025-08-25 17:52:12
I still get a thrill when that opening riff hits—'With You' is one of those raw, early Linkin Park tracks that feels like a fist in the chest. It was released on the band's debut album 'Hybrid Theory', which came out on October 24, 2000. The song itself wasn’t pushed as a commercial single the way 'In the End' or 'Crawling' were, but it’s a core album cut that fans instantly recognize for its blend of aggressive verses and melodic choruses.
